Position Summary

The Construction Representative will support projects at Dyess AFB. The Construction Representative serves as the on-site quality assurance representative responsible for monitoring contractor performance, ensuring compliance with contract requirements, verifying construction quality, and supporting successful project delivery from pre-construction through project closeout.

Duties/Responsibilities
  • Observe and inspect construction activities to ensure compliance with contract plans, specifications, schedules, safety requirements, and quality standards.
  • Perform daily site inspections and document project activities, contractor performance, safety observations, work progress, and manpower levels using RMS and other project management systems.
  • Monitor construction schedules and advise the Resident Engineer, COR, and project team of potential delays, schedule impacts, or performance concerns.
  • Review and analyze contractor submittals, including shop drawings, quality control plans, safety plans, environmental plans, certifications, and progress schedules.
  • Participate in the review and processing of Requests for Information (RFIs), coordinating responses with designers, engineers, technical experts, and project stakeholders.
  • Prepare correspondence regarding contractor performance, Requests for Equitable Adjustments (REAs), contract compliance issues, and technical concerns.
  • Conduct quality assurance inspections throughout all phases of construction and verify compliance with the three-phase inspection process.
  • Assist in developing scopes of work, government estimates, contract modifications, and technical evaluations of contractor proposals.
  • Review contractor payment requests and assist in preparing partial and final payment estimates, including verification of quantities completed and materials stored on-site.
  • Monitor contractor compliance with OSHA standards, EM 385-1-1 Safety and Health Requirements Manual, environmental requirements, and site-specific safety plans.
  • Maintain project records, logs, reports, photographs, inspection documentation, and construction correspondence.
  • Support project meetings, progress reviews, partnering sessions, and customer site visits.
  • Assist with project closeout activities, punch-list inspections, turnover documentation, and warranty tracking.

Education/Experience
  • High School Diploma or GED required; Associate's or Bachelor's degree in Construction Management, Engineering, Architecture, or a related field preferred.
  • Minimum of 5 years of experience supporting large, complex construction projects.
  • Experience with federal construction projects, Department of Defense (DoD), Air Force, or U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) projects strongly preferred.
  • Experience inspecting and monitoring construction quality, schedules, contractor performance, and contract compliance.
  • Working knowledge of construction methods, building systems, plans, specifications, and contract documents.
  • Experience with the USACE Three-Phase Quality Control System preferred.
  • Experience using RMS 3.0 or similar construction management software preferred.
  • Knowledge of OSHA regulations and EM 385-1-1 Safety and Health Requirements Manual preferred.
  • Ability to review and interpret engineering drawings, shop drawings, technical specifications, and construction schedules.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.
  • Strong organizational and documentation skills with attention to detail.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ite, including Word, Excel, Outlook, and PowerPoint.
  • Ability to obtain and maintain access to military installations.
